Currently, lots of studies in the field of teaching Chinese as a second language have been undergoing, especially in the "Three Aspects of Teaching", i.e. Teachers, teaching materials and methods of teaching. Meanwhile, during the course, two other aspects could not be ignored either, which are the study of the language learner and the studying environment. Each way of language teaching fits certain language learners, and if they are wrongly matched, little effect would there be. As the development of the research of learning a second language, more and more studies about learners are carried out. Some of the studies show that the facts lie in the learner can decide whether learners will make major progress in language learning. However, among many of the factors which affect the learning results, studying motivation is the core.This article, based on the achievement has been made by experts both in and out of the country, has adopted the methods of questionnaires and interviewing etc. to research and analyze the students’motivation in Phnom Penh, Cambodia. According to the result, most of the learners from the region have strong and complex motivation. They have shown integration motivation, instrumental motivation, intrinsic motivation and extrinsic motivation, among which the instrumental motivation is more protruding; Chinese language learners would show different types of motivation if they have differences in the aspects of sex, age, education and time spent in the learning; A lot of factors and reasons could influent their motivation. Moreover, the article has given some suggestions in regards to the Chinese studying situation in Cambodia to provide some reference if needed. In the teaching process, teachers should stimulate students’motivation accordingly to achieve better result in studying and teaching.
